The Serial Number Report tracks outbound products, the orders they shipped in, and the date shipped. Tracking serial numbers is important because it allows you to trace exactly which customer received which specific product, making it easier to manage warranties, handle recalls, investigate defects, and provide better customer support.

Accessing the Serial Number Report

Login to your dashboard and navigate to Reports > Serial Numbers

Serial Number Report

After the item ships and a serial number is scanned or entered, it's available in the serial number report. The report records all the scanned serial numbers but not when the feature was enabled. To download the serial number track, go to the report's tab, select serial numbers, and store the date range.

Serial numbers can also be seen at the individual order level by hovering over the Shipments panel on the order page.

Notes

  1. Turning off serial numbers is not possible if It's already been setup.

  2. Serial numbers do not work on Kits or Build Kits.

  3. Serial numbers are not on supported on Bulk Ship.
